Went into Wholesale Sports in Portland to buy some BBQ stuff and look at the guns. I always look at the guns and wonder why anyone would want the ones that seem to big to even hold. Anyway having been recommended a certain firearm for my needs by an expect friend in Texas I decided to inquire if they had one. About 30 minutes later I was walking out the store carrying said firearm, two boxes of ammunition, use them for practice only the guy said they wouldn't stop anyone attacking you, and assorted BBQ requisites.
Why am I amazed apart from signing me up for the theory part of the Clackamas Country concealed weapon permit course there was no mention of do I know how to use a firearm, I don't. The reason they signed me up for the course at the store because this Thursday it is a special at $10 not the usual $40. Do I consider myself safe with a firearm, no I don't but they sold me one anyway. Now fortunately I have the sense to take myself down to Clackamas Country Sheriff's range and sign up for the basic firearms course as a starting point. But to my obviously simplistic way of thinking shouldn't the courses come before being allowed to buy the thing in the first place.

To get a CCP you have to do a theory course about the Oregon law and when you can use a firearm in self defense, also a basic firearms course on a range. The latter I'll do on the Sheriff's Public Safety Range, but as to being buddies with the deputies it is amazing how many doors get opened to retired Scotland Yard Detectives the ony thing it has never get me is a worthwhile job offer.
